Subject: DrawLoom 3.2 — undo/redo rework ready for review

Team, the undo stack in DrawLoom now records command deltas instead of full canvas snapshots, cutting memory use sharply on large diagrams. Redo is invalidated correctly after any new edit, and grouped moves collapse into one history entry. Please test nested group rotations carefully before sign-off. The build token for this candidate is appended below.

build token for fajof-yahof: htk4_869f

Ticket: Staging env misconfigured for Siftgate bloom filter

The bloom layer in front of the Pellet KV store is rejecting all lookups in staging because the env file was copied from the dev template without credentials. False-positive tuning values are fine; only the auth line is missing. To unblock the weekly demo, the Pellet admission secret must be set on the following line.

env line for yaguf-fajop: LEDGER_TOKEN13=fb08984397349

Subject: Calendar sync cut-over — summary

Hi — the cut-over from the legacy Tidemark sync to the new Planwell conflict-resolution service completed last night. Two-way sync was frozen for 40 minutes; all queued conflicts were replayed and resolved with last-writer-wins, as agreed. We verified 312 sample events across three tenant groups with no duplicates or phantom deletions. Rollback remains possible for 72 hours. For your records, the service is now running with the following configuration.

deployment values, kajep-kageg:
[praix]
host = praix.paliqcorp.corp
user = praix_svc
database = praix_prod

Artifact signing for Ledgerlens, the audit-log viewer. All release tarballs must be signed before upload to the Cravenmoor mirror; unsigned builds are rejected at ingest. On-call: if a hotfix is needed, build from the release branch only, verify checksums, then sign. Rotation happens quarterly; stale keys fail loudly. The current signing key is provided immediately below.

deploy key for kajof-yawif: bky9_fvxrpdHPq